Book excerpt: The Business of Golf is a series of two books with a passionate focus on creating value for the golfer based on a foundation that produces a return on an investment for the golf course owner. The Business of Golf What Are You Thinking? functions as a primer for avid golfers, college students in Professional Golf Management Programs, and golf industry professionals seeking to refresh their knowledge on the fundamentals of the golf industry and operating a golf course. This book garnered widespread appeal, due to its singularity as a source that provides strategic, tactical, and operational guidance, It has been purchased in over 16 countries and is used by 15 universities and colleges in their curriculums. In contrast to the basic primer, The Business of Golf Why? How? What?, first published in 2013, caters to the seasoned industry professional. The book guides a golf course management team in creating a strategic vision, determining the resources to be allocated and the policies and procedures that require consistent execution, accompanied with 21 templates that can be licensed at www.golfconfergence.com. Both of these books represents over a decade of research conducted in partnership with golf courses worldwide. The perspective contained in both addresses comprehensible and executable principals that encompass a diverse range of subjects including architecture, agronomy, intellectual property, rate structures, social media, water utilization and yield management. While the insights presented are clear, the analysis undertaken was extensive. The principles in these books formed an integral part of a Clemson University Ed. D.D. dissertation in which 11 leading golf course managers operating 34 golf courses vetted and validated the principals herein contained. Assurance of identifying the potential of a facility resides in the application of the books' concepts. These books help the golf course management team and staff develop a focused and disciplined approach based on quantitative data to identify and mitigate the impact of uncontrollable factors (economy, location and weather). From understanding these fundamentals, the controllable factors can be leveraged to enhance each golfer's qualitative experience while ensuring a positive financial return on investment to the golf course stake-holders.

Book excerpt: The next time you play golf leave your woods at home, putt with your 2-iron, and you will be on your way to shooting in the 70s. Sounds radical? Well, you're right on par! Golf enthusiast Michael Laughlin, whose day job is in the film business, reveals his proven, but completely radical strategies that average golfers can use to dramatically lower their score. In Radical Golf, Laughlin rethinks how the game of golf is traditionally played and shares his surprising and innovative ideas on how to play better golf. Unlike the usual technique-riddled golf books, Radical Golf offers practical and easy-to-use tips, and is written for the legion of average players who will never have the long, crunching power game of the professional. "Golf is not a linear game," insists Laughlin, and "Scoring is definitely not related to advancing the ball as far as possible on each shot." In this fun and accessible book, the radical golfer contends, for example, that players should approach the pin much like basketball players maneuver to shoot a basket by striving to shoot from their best, or "sweet" spot on the court. Laughlin also suggests that golf should be played as two separate games (of tee-to-green and putts) and that golfers should keep a separate scorecard for their putting game. Equally radical, Radical Golf calls for using a 2-iron for putts rather than the "dreaded" putter (the loft of the 2-iron matches the putter, "Calamity Jane," of legendary golfer Bobby Jones). Hole by hole, sensible shot after sensible shot, Radical Golf simulates a round of golf with a pro to show how a radical golfer can stay within strokes of par play. Written in a witty and easy-to-understand style, with entertaining sidebars and line drawings, Radical Golf will revolutionize how golf is played both on and off the course. Most of all, Radical Golf will increase the enjoyment of playing this great and challenging game. Radical Golf is just the book that could become the bible of the weekend golfer.

Book excerpt: The latest golf book from Dear (Every Golf Question You Ever Wanted Answered) meets the formidable challenge of trying to tell the 600-year history of golf.... a Masters-level celebration of the game. -- Publishers Weekly (starred review) The people and events that shaped golf's 600-year history. The Story of Golf in Fifty Holes explores the 600-year history of the game of honor. It reveals the excitement and despair, the challenges overcome and the sweet victories, the sportsmanship and the stars bursting onto the scene. It also describes the developments in course design, like the first manmade water hazard, and the first central fairways bunkers. In 50 chapters, the book describes the holes, their contribution to golf course architecture, their importance to the careers of specific players, and their place in the overall story of golf. The book also features: Design and Layout illustrations of the 50 holes The year, course, location and map, distance and par for each hole Color and archival photographs of the players and tournament events Sidebars with additional stories of interest. The 50 stories cover the globe and generations of players, including: 5th North Berwick, the original Redan hole 18th Glen Abbey, where Tiger Woods had what many call the greatest shot ever hit 12th Atlantic Country Club, where the term birdie was first used 18th Royal Birkdale, home to the concession. Book excerpt: People do business with individuals they like, trust, admire and respect. That's why knowing how to play golf is such an important business tool. It's not about the deals you make while you're on the course - it's about the relationships you build that can lead to deals. In one round of golf, you're able to establish a solid relational foundation.Why? Because the golf course perfectly replicates the business world in showing how people function when they're confronted with challenges that affect their individual performance. You can tell a great deal about how people operate in the business world by spending time with them on the golf course. Book excerpt: No matter how sophisticated the tools become-the e-mails and teleconferencing, the BlackBerries and PowerPoints-golf remains the true communications hub of American business In the history of American business there have been more deals consummated on the golf course than in any boardroom or five-star restaurant. It's no accident that executives from J. D. Rockefeller to Jack Welch have made time in their busy schedules for eighteen holes. Deals on the Green takes a fresh look at the interesting worlds of golf and business. It's not a "how to win business" instructional, but it does offer lessons about what is required to succeed in golf and in business-namely friendship, imagination, tenacity, multitasking, guts, passion, and compassion. And it shares great inside stories about the leaders whose devotion to and respect for the game have contributed to their success in business. Financial journalist David Rynecki takes us inside the gates of elite courses such as Augusta National and Pebble Beach to reveal how the wealthy and powerful really behave-or misbehave. He lets us in on the keys to mixing business and pleasure, the best way to swing a nine iron in front of your boss, and even what to do if you happen to slice it.
